What were some of the newly introduced technologies during World War I? Are some of those 'technologies' still used today? Which

ones? What are some examples of technology in today's world that are/were as revolutionary as those introduced in WWI?
History
1 answer:
Arlecino [84]3 years ago
4 0

Answer: The Invention of the timer gear on fighter aircraft, the monoplane and more advanced aircraft such as fighter and bombers. the tank, the submarine, the machine gun, the dreadnought, the semi-auto rifle, chemical weapons, and the sub-machine gun. The tank, the submarine, the machine gun, semi-auto rifle, and the sub-machine gun are all still used today.

Why did Santa Anna send soldiers to Gonzales
Kay [80]
On October 2, 1835, the growing tensions between Mexico and Texas erupt into violence when Mexican soldiers attempt to disarm the people of Gonzales, sparking the Texan war for independence. Texas—or Tejas as the Mexicans called it—had technically been a part of the Spanish empire since the 17th century.
